Greyhound Indoor Track & Field Teams to Begin 2018-19 on December 1 at Lehigh Season Opener

BETHLEHEM, Pa. --- The Moravian College men's and women's indoor track & field squads are scheduled to open 2018-19 season on Saturday, December 1 at the Lehigh University Season Opener in Rauch Fieldhouse with the meet starting at 10:00 a.m.

Eighth-year Head Coach Jesse Baumann looks to have both of the Greyhounds' teams challenge for the 2019 Landmark Conference Indoor Championship in February at Susquehanna University. The women have won 10 of 11 Landmark Conference Indoor titles, returning to the top of the podium in 2018 after a runner-up finish in 2017. The men have also won 10 of 11 possible Landmark indoor titles including nine straight.

The women's team has 28 returnees including seven competitors that earned Landmark All-Conference honors a year ago. Leading that group is senior Amari Schooler, who looks to win the 60-meter hurdles for the fourth straight year, and she earned All-Conference Second Team honors in the 60-meter dash. Junior Carly Danoski is back to defend her title in the 800-meter run while senior Anna Osman looks to repeat in the 400-meter dash.

Senior Jordan Luciano aims to defend her title in the long jump, and she also returns along with sophomore Camaryn Wheeler from the Greyhounds' winning 4x200-meter relay squad. Danoski and Osman are back from the 4x400-meter relay title team. Sophomore Tatiana Lopez earned All-Conference Second Team accolades in the 60-meter hurdles last February while sophomore Jenevieve Eberly was second in the long jump a year ago.          

The men's squad has 27 returning student-athletes including 10 All-Conference performers. Senior hurdler John Spirk aims to capture the 60-meter hurdles for the fourth time this winter, and he returns after being named the 2018 Landmark Conference Indoor Male Track Athlete of the Year after also winning the 400-meter dash and 4x200-meter relay a year ago. Sophomore Zion Howard, the 2018 Landmark Conference Male Rookie of the Year, will try to defend his title in the 200-meter dash, and he ran with Spirk on the winning 4x200-meter relay squad while earning All-Conference Second Team honors with a runner-up finish in the 60-meter dash.

Senior Scott Goodwin looks to win his third straight title in the pole vault while junior Greg Jaindl is gunning for a repeat in the 5,000-meter run, and he earned All-Conference Second Team honors in the 3,000-meter run. Sophomore Shane Mastro is back to defend his title in the shot put while seniors Chris Antoine and Brian Stock are back to run in the 4x200-meter relay again. Junior Justin Beasley-Turner and sophomore Peter Gingrich return half of Moravian's winning distance medley relay squad. Stock was the runner-up in the long jump last February while junior Ryan Harper took home All-Conference Second Team honors in both the shot put and weight throw.
